Meltham Golf Club sits on the high moorland fringe south of Huddersfield, in the Colne Valley corridor where West Yorkshire gives way to the open Pennine uplands. This is classic northern English hillside golf — exposed, honest, and entirely unimpressed by airs and graces. The course occupies ground that rewards local knowledge, with the kind of turf that drains fast in summer and bites back hard in a westerly.
The village of Meltham itself is a small mill town community, and the club carries that character: a members' club in the truest sense, built and sustained by people who actually live here and play here through all four seasons. Par 70 suits the moorland template well — expect a layout that prizes accuracy and course management over raw power, where the terrain does much of the design work.
For visiting golfers, the draw is the landscape as much as the golf itself. Wide skies, sweeping views across the valley, and an authenticity that more manicured destinations simply cannot manufacture.
| Tee | Yards | Rating | Slope | Par |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| White · men | 6,259 | 71.8 | 133 | 70 |
| Yellow · men | 5,990 | 70.5 | 128 | 70 |
| Red - 2018 · women | 5,610 | 74.3 | 137 | 73 |
| Green · men | 5,267 | 66.7 | 121 | 68 |
| Green - Women · women | 5,267 | 72 | 134 | 73 |
